sangria 0,1. Otherwise, if sangria could be clearer to you, here's a scala worksheet with a very simplistic example based off play + sangria - in this case you would just need to swap the json library. api graphql sangria scala. A quick refresh of what is going on here. The game is set in medieval Spain, where feudal lords scheme for power over the nine provinces, and the Royal Court. import io.circe. Sangria is a software implementation of the famous german board game quot;El Grandequot;. GitHub® and the Octocat® logo … _ import sangria. Support for Functional Programming, rich ecosystem and stable foundation allow building fast applications, quickly. Gitter & Mailing List. Sangria & Scala Futures, round 1 . Sangria scalar type derived from Circe encoder and decoder - package.scala. Creating a Scala application with Sangria and GraphQL We first want to take a look at our main and only controller defined in app/AppController.scala , which defines a few methods … To use it, one defines the GraphQL schema by defining types, fields, and, for each field, how to solve it. Sangria is a awesome GraphQL lib for scala. Downloads. https://sangria-graphql.github.io/ I would also recommend you to check out Sangria Playground. For … schema. {ScalarAlias, StringType} case class ResultData(resultId: ResultId) object ResultData { implicit val derived = deriveInputObjectType[ResultData]() } object ResultId { //Already … The latest version of the library is 2.0.0.You can view and download the sources directly from the GitHub … It is an example of GraphQL server written with Play framework and Sangria. Scala is a very popular language nowadays and it’s often chosen to deliver efficient and scalable systems. https://sangria-graphql.github.io/ I would also recommend you to check out Sangria Playground . It is an example of GraphQL server written with Play framework and Sangria. execution. Sangria and Future Sangria is a Scala library implementing GraphQL on the server side. and the http server as well but it's a simple case of swapping in the function definitions. macros. Scala GraphQL implementation. Armed with this high-level overview of how a Scala application uses GraphQL with the help of Sangria, we can now focus on the application. When Oleg started this library, he used the Scala Future as m… Releases - v1.0.0-RC2 zip tar ... Disclaimer: This project is not affiliated with the GitHub company in any way. {Decoder, Encoder} import sangria.macros.derive.deriveInputObjectType import sangria.schema. When you are asking a question, be sure to add scala, graphql and sangria tags, so that other people can easily find them. Sangria - Scala GraphQL Implementation. ... We use optional third-party analytics cookies to understand how you use GitHub.com so we can build better products. It leverages the Java VM, known for its reliability and robustness. I use sangria-graphql/sangria Top Contributors. The db is mocked (perhaps you use Slick?) Homepage Gitter Developer Star Fork Watch Issue Download. It uses case classes in the documentation and provide a set of macros to derive some stuff from them. Sangria : A Scala GraphQL library that supports Relay. # An example of a hello world GraphQL schema and query with sangria: import sangria. In this post we will see shapeless HMaps and again, use the sangria-akka-http-example as basis for our adventure. Sangria scalar type derived from Circe encoder and decoder - package.scala. _ import sangria.
Mermaid Swamp Endings, Little Italy Foods Marinara Pasta Sauce, Envision Math Grade 5 Lesson 1 1, Resting Heart Rate For 45 Year Old Woman, City And Colour - Comin Home Tab, Intercontinental Tokyo Bar, Coton De Tulear Breeders Midwest, Why Is Ben And Jerry's So Expensive Uk, Isuzu Engines For Sale,